How the Product is Used:
Teachers can easily prepare these activities by printing each component on 8.5x11 sheets. For the Write the Room activity, the images are placed around the room for students to find and identify. The Lacing Cards just need their holes punched for threading. The Cut and Paste Crafts are printed and ready to be cut out and assembled by students. Finally, the Play Dough Mats invite students to mold ocean objects with play dough, encouraging creativity and fine motor practice.

Winter Roll-a-Story Prompts | Creative Writing Fun for 1st & 2nd Graders
By Pearlie Janes Creations
Make winter writing exciting with this interactive Roll-a-Story Prompts set! Students roll a die to choose a character, problem, and setting from three winter-themed sheets, then use the provided paper to draft and write their stories. This resource combines creativity, critical thinking, and writing practice into a fun and engaging activity perfect for classrooms or at home.
